一、智能卡是什么
智能卡(Smart Card)是內(nèi)嵌有微芯片的塑料卡(通常是一張信用卡的大小)的通稱。一些智能卡包含一個(gè)微電子芯片,智能卡需要通過讀寫器進(jìn)行數(shù)據(jù)交互。
智能卡配備有CPU、RAM和I/O,可自行處理數(shù)量較多的數(shù)據(jù)而不會(huì)干擾到主機(jī)CPU的工作。智能卡還可過濾錯(cuò)誤的數(shù)據(jù),以減輕主機(jī)CPU的負(fù)擔(dān)。適應(yīng)于端口數(shù)目較多且通信速度需求較快的場(chǎng)合??▋?nèi)的集成電路包括中央處理器CPU、可編程只讀存儲(chǔ)器EEPROM、隨機(jī)存儲(chǔ)器RAM和固化在只讀存儲(chǔ)器ROM中的卡內(nèi)操作系統(tǒng)COS(Chip Operating System)??ㄖ袛?shù)據(jù)分為外部讀取和內(nèi)部處理部分。
智能卡是以IC卡技術(shù)為核心,以計(jì)算機(jī)和通信技術(shù)為手段,將智能建筑內(nèi)部的各項(xiàng)設(shè)施連接成為一個(gè)有機(jī)的整體,用戶通過一張IC卡便可完成通常的鑰匙、資金結(jié)算、考勤和某些控制操作,如用lC卡開啟房門、IC卡就餐、購(gòu)物、娛樂、會(huì)議、停車、巡更、辦公、收費(fèi)服務(wù)等各項(xiàng)活動(dòng)。
二、智能卡有哪些優(yōu)缺點(diǎn)
1、智能卡優(yōu)點(diǎn)
(1)便于隨身攜帶:光卡可以方便地放到錢包中或者卡包中,可以郵寄。
(2)存儲(chǔ)容量大:一張卡可保存4-6兆字節(jié)的信息。其它便攜式信息介質(zhì)(磁卡、IC卡、縮微膠片)均無法與其相比。
(3)信息記錄的高可靠性與高安全性:由于是激光打孔式的記錄方法,因此該卡片不怕任何電/磁干擾,有很強(qiáng)的抗水,抗污染及抗劇烈溫度變化的能力。任何人以任何方法試圖改變卡中信息的內(nèi)容,必須留下痕跡。
(4)高保密性:Canon光卡擁有獨(dú)特設(shè)計(jì)的光卡信息保密措施,可以做到一卡一碼,該碼無法用常規(guī)方法讀取,更無法破譯。
2、智能卡缺點(diǎn)
智能卡主要缺點(diǎn)是并非所有智能卡讀卡器都兼容所有類型的智能卡。有多種類型的智能卡,有些使用非標(biāo)準(zhǔn)協(xié)議進(jìn)行數(shù)據(jù)存儲(chǔ)和卡接口;一些智能卡和讀卡器也使用與其他讀卡器不兼容的專有軟件。
雖然智能卡對(duì)于許多應(yīng)用程序來說可能更安全,但它們?nèi)匀蝗菀资艿侥承╊愋偷墓簟?梢酝ㄟ^智能卡技術(shù)從芯片恢復(fù)信息的攻擊。差分功率分析可用于推斷公鑰算法(如RSA)使用的片上私鑰。對(duì)稱密碼的一些實(shí)現(xiàn)也易受定時(shí)攻擊或差分功率分析的影響。還可以物理地拆卸智能卡以便訪問機(jī)載微芯片。